Since onboarding the Brindlewood cluster, the Corvette gateway has intermittently failed to resolve internal service names. The root cause is a race between our sidecar cache expiry and the upstream Quillhaven resolver's rotation window: when both fire within the same second, lookups return stale NXDOMAIN for up to ninety seconds. As a contractor new to this stack, please do not change retry logic without reading the appendix first. The mitigation we shipped pins the following tuning constants, reproduced here for reference.

tuning table, yajog-yahof:
BUDGETS = {
    "lamvan": 303,
    "wenox": 460,
    "fenvan": 525,
}

Re: Term sheet from Pellgrave Industries.

Pellgrave has delivered a term sheet for the proposed co-manufacturing arrangement covering the Arden line. Key points: a three-year initial term, shared tooling costs, and volume commitments beginning in the second year. Counsel has flagged the termination provisions as one-sided; we intend to negotiate. Finance projects a neutral cash impact in year one and favorable margins thereafter. We request board feedback before the next negotiation round on the 14th. Strategic context is provided below.

internal memo for kawip-hadug: Headcount on the Wenwyn team goes from 7 to 140 by the end of January. Gross margin on Wenwyn came in at 20 percent against a plan of 15 percent.

Action item from the Tumblebin locker outage (owner: release). The access flow stalled because unlock tokens expired while the door controller was still polling, leaving customers locked out at the Harwick Street site. Fix is merged: tokens now refresh mid-poll and the controller retries with backoff. Before the next release train, the lease and retry values must be verified against the staging lockers. The constants as currently configured are listed below.

tuning table, kajog-bawip:
TIERS = {
    "kelius": 256,
    "lammir": 543,
}

Handover note — Tidemark tide-table widget. The widget pulls predictions from the Saltgrass forecast service and caches them for six hours. If customers report blank tables, the cache refresh job has usually stalled; restarting it resolves the issue within minutes. Coastal station names are mapped in a static config, so new stations require a deploy. Known issue: daylight-saving transitions can shift times by an hour. Escalations should go to the engineer named below.

approver of yajef-fajef = Oliwyn Silion Kasok Kasox